通过hive,如何获取最近的记录?

tvokkenx  于 2021-06-02  发布在  Hadoop
关注(0)|答案(1)|浏览(1057)

在配置单元表(地址表)中,我有1000条记录,许多记录是重复的,比如,一条记录的地址时间戳是10年前的,一条记录的新地址时间戳是1年前的,一条记录的最近地址时间戳是今天的
如何获取最近的地址记录?

h5qlskok

h5qlskok1#

使用cte和windowingandanalytics函数rank with over和partition by子句可以做到这一点。
如果仍然觉得难以共享完整的表模式,并将有助于查询。。

相关问题